Abstract :
In this paper we describe specific application of digital watermarking: Video watermarking for Copyright protection. Literature survey suggests that most video watermarking techniques use static 3D Discrete Cosine Transform technique. In this paper, we show the result of implementation of static 3 D DCT. We observe that this scheme works well on correlated videos. But it does not take care of scene change in the video. Hence we propose dynamic size 3D-DCT technique (by "scene change detection") for embedding binary/ gray scale/ color watermark on a color digital video and compare our results with existing fixed length 3D-DCT technique.
